Australia continues AD & CVD measures on China’s silicon metal

The Australian Anti-Dumping Commission announced that the Minister for Industry and Science has accepted the Commission's final ruling of the second anti-dumping (AD) and countervailing duty (CVD) sunset reviews on silicon metal from China, deciding to continue to impose AD and CVD duties on these products in the form of ad valorem measures, valid from June 4, 2025.

The interim AD duty rate is 16.2%, the interim CVD rate is 29.4%, and the combined interim AD and CVD duty rate is 45.6%.

The products involved are under Australian HS code 2804.69.00.14.
